Hope these pictures help describe the area and ramp a bit better. It should be noted that the silver bar does swing out of the way when not in use.
 
Thanks Tyler. Great pictures. I used this new bus twice on my trip last February. It is a relief to know that this type bus seems more reliable. One driver was able to lower the ramp manually when the electonics failed.
 
Used the Gillig once on my trip last week. Awesome. So easy to just drive on and get in place. I had no problems in the space of one bench.

If there is a curb, and the driver does not kneel the bus, the ramp power will not come on. The GREAT thing about this flip out ramp is that no matter what, it can be EASILY manually operated, so theres never any downtime. :)
 
That's good to know as I have been trapped on buses a few times. Once for several hours. Lift broke and they couldn't get it to go up or down. Was half way up and jammed.
